We point out the advantages of the use of x-ray resist as the recording medium in contact x-ray micrography, with subsequent viewing under the scanning electron microscope. Untreated specimens may be replicated with a resolution better than 100 nm. Photographs of latex spheres obtained by this technique are presented.

The structure of regenerated cellulose is shown by x-ray diffraction to be comprised of an array of antiparallel chain molecules. The determination was based on the intensity data from rayon fibers and utilized rigid-body least-squares refinement techniques. The unit cell is monoclinic with space group P2(1) and dimen…

The α → β phase transition in quartz and in the isostructural AlPO4 has been studied in situ in an electron microscope. A very high density of defects was observed close to the transition temperature. A diffraction contrast analysis allowed us to identify these defects as dauphiné twins.
